Description of Wellington International School – Dubai

  • Year of foundation: 2005
  • Location: Dubai, UAE
  • Age of students: 4+
  • Number of students: 3000+
  • Language of instruction: English
  • Type of study: international school.

Located in Al Sufouha in Dubai, on a campus of over 3 hectares, the pioneering international private school offers a wide range of opportunities and resources combining modern and relevant global education and unique infrastructure.

More than 3 thousand students of all groups, from FS-1 to Year 13, study within the walls of the school. The school is accredited by the British Council and is a member of the BSO, for 12 years it has received an "excellent" rating during the KHDA audit. In addition, the school is accredited under the International Baccalaureate program, is a member of the CIS Council of International Schools, a certified member of the Council of British International Schools COBIS, a partner of the UN Institute for Research UNITAR, a number of national and local awards and incentives for outstanding contribution to the community. Finally, along with British accreditations, the Wellington International School boasts membership in the New England Association of Schools and Colleges NEASC and the Middle States Association's Primary and Secondary Schools Commission.

Activities Wellington International School – Dubai

The school offers an exciting, inclusive "Explore, Enrich, Excite" program that provides access to a variety of clubs, competitions, activities and initiatives (both before class and in the afternoon, as well as after school).

The program is divided into 6 areas:

  • sport
  • language and literature,
  • STEM,
  • creation
  • music and performing arts,
  • well-being.

This allows students with different interests to choose an activity to their liking.

Sports activities, in addition to physical education lessons, offer a wide range of teams for students in grades 3-13, including cricket, gymnastics, tennis, rugby, football, basketball and netball, swimming and athletics.  Students can develop their athletic talents outside of school (Wellington has partnered with dozens of teams and academies both in the Middle East and elsewhere).

In addition, teenagers can engage in drawing, sculpture, dramatic arts and theatrical skills, rehearse and engage in junior and senior choir, brass band, guitar club and recording studio. Classes do not require experience, children can join them at any time.

Along with local schools, the school invites students to take part in global initiatives and projects in partnership with TEDx, Model United Nations, Harvard Project Zero and World Scholars. More than 100 students take part in the Duke of Edinburgh Award programme from bronze to gold level, developing the communication, leadership and service skills needed to support both university and career aspirations.

Finally, the partnership with the ArtsEd School of Performing Arts in London allows gifted children to go to one of the three-week intensive camps (in the final, teenagers put on a show for parents), and the most successful students can apply for an ArtsEd scholarship.

Facilities and equipment at Wellington International School – Dubai

Students have access to modern equipment and infrastructure, including:

  • A fully equipped library with hundreds of academic publications, journal subscriptions and full-text databases;
  • Modern ICT tools, a separate information and center Sixth Form;
  • All classrooms are equipped with modern interactive whiteboards and projection equipment, connected to the Internet, which allows students to use both school-owned and their own devices;
  • Construction, water, music, sand and gardening zone for junior high school students, as well as thematic learning areas in the corridors of the school: creative, active, digital and STEAM;
  • Creative facilities such as classical music classrooms, individual and group rehearsal rooms, three reading rooms, a studio where students can work with sound and video;
  • Falcon Center – a specialized area for Sixth Form students, equipped with facilities, social areas, kitchen and dining room, IT laboratories;
  • A spacious cafeteria, used not only for reception, but also for cooking for educational purposes, several dining rooms.

The sports infrastructure is also very rich, allowing students to lead a healthy and active lifestyle, discover and develop their talents:

  • Full-size lawn with 3D illumination,
  • Fully equipped health and fitness studio,
  • Large multi-purpose sports hall,
  • Gym with viewing gallery,
  • Cricket nets,
  • Tennis, basketball, netball and volleyball courts,
  • 25-meter indoor swimming pool,
  • Outdoor swimming pool,
  • Play equipment areas,
  • Dance studio.

Enrolment process

  • Send by e-mail fresh reports on academic performance from school or kindergarten, which will allow the admission committee to make a preliminary decision;
  • As a rule, students are exempt from the need to pass entrance exams (except in individual cases);
  • Students older than the 5th grade should write a motivation letter in which they are invited to talk about themselves, their hobbies and interests, talents and achievements - this will help to get to know the child better and check how he meets the requirements of the school;
  • After reviewing the application, letter and package of documents, representatives of the school will contact the family to make a final decision.

Parents should ensure that they have provided all the necessary up-to-date information about their child in the appendix to the online application form, including information about the presence of diseases, allergic reactions, current contact information and phone numbers.

Reports from the previous school or kindergarten are subject to evaluation with a possible subsequent interview or examination.

The number of places is limited, applications are considered on a first-come, first-served basis.

Students wishing to take the IB must achieve the minimum established requirements in their GCSE or similar exam.

Entry requirements, how to apply, what is required to enrol

To enroll, you must fill out an online form and pay the registration fee of 525 AED (cash, bank transfer, online payment or check are accepted).

Together with the application for registration, the following documents must be sent:

  • A certified copy of the birth certificate in English or Arabic;
  • Copy of passport and visa;
  • A copy of the local identity card;
  • Vaccination card;
  • Copies of the last school report card for 2 years;
  • Medical declaration;
  • A copy of the vaccination card;
  • Copy of sponsorship visa;
  • Personal motivation statement (for students of the 5th and higher grades).

Scholarships Wellington International School – Dubai

The school has a merit-based scholarship program designed to encourage successful students who have academic, athletic, creative, scientific and innovative distinctions. To obtain it is necessary to submit an application to the administration. In case of a positive decision, applicants will receive an individually determined amount, which is calculated separately each academic year. To extend the scholarship, it is necessary to re-apply, meeting the academic criteria.
